| Value | Name | Behavior | | :--- | :--- | :--- | | | Lowest | Never roam. "Death grip" on the original AP. | | 2 | Medium-Low | Roam only when signal is very poor. | | 3 | Medium (Default) | Balanced approach. Works for most stationary users. | | 4 | Medium-High | Roam when signal is moderately weak. | | 5 | Highest | Roam very aggressively. Dump any AP the moment a slightly better one appears. |
